1. Handmade Thanksgiving Wreath
Create a festive wreath using fall leaves, acorns, dried citrus slices, and jute twine. Use a grapevine base, weave in seasonal natural elements, and add a touches of ribbon or dried florals for contrast. This rustic wreath looks beautiful on your door and radiates autumn charm effortlessly.
2. DIY Pinecone Turkey Ornaments
Transform simple pinecones into adorable Thanksgiving turkeys! Attach googly eyes, felt beaks and legs, and paint tiny feather details. Hang them on your tree or gift them as handmade tokens to loved ones. They bring joy and a touch of nature’s beauty right into your home.

3. Gratitude Parsley Stoneware Jars
Handwrite heartfelt notes of gratitude on small paper slips and tuck them into clear glass jars decorated with painted leaves or twine. These heartfelt keepsakes double as charming centerpieces or thoughtful gifts for family and friends.
4. Paper Leaf Garland
Gather fall-colored construction paper and cut out leaf shapes in varying sizes. String them together to form a glowing paper garland that brings vibrant autumn color to walls, mantels, or windowsills. Perfect for quick, stunning ambiance!
5. Miniature Thanksgiving Place Cards
Design and cut tiny card templates shaped like leaves, pumpkins, or turkeys. Decorate with markers, washi tape, and pressed flowers, then use them to personalize place settings. They add warmth and a handmade touch to holiday meals.

6. Hand-Painted Pebble Displays
Paint small or pebbles with autumn themes—maple leaves, turkeys, pumpkins—and arrange them in clear jars or shadow boxes. These mini masterpieces make gorgeous, portable decor or thoughtful handmade gifts for friends and family.
7. Autumn-Themed Paper Craft Wreaths
Use colorful cardstock or scrapbook paper to cut leaf shapes or seasonal silhouettes. Layer them over a foam base for a vibrant paper wreath that feels both eco-friendly and full of heart.
8. Thankful Tree Decoration
Create a symbolic “Thanksgiving Tree” by drawing a large tree trunk on a poster or canvas. Each leaf represents something you’re grateful for; attach handwritten notes with markers. It’s a welcoming, inspiring addition to your home or office.
9. Mini Turkey Cookie Cutter Art
Use cookie cutters to stamp playful turkeys onto redesigned fall-themed cookies or paper. Pair with illustrative leaves and stars for birthday-style thankful decorations that are perfect for hosting and gifting.
10. Leaf Rubbing Collage
Collect autumn leaves of different shapes and sizes, place them under paper, and rub over with crayons or pencils to create textured art. Compile these into a collage or journal spread—nature’s artwork in front of you all year long.
